How Posture Correctors Work

What all posture correctors have in common is that they are designed to address the muscle imbalances that arise when we are in unhealthy, fixed postures for extended periods of time. While the muscles in the front of the chest (pectoralis) tend to tighten, the muscles in the upper back, including the middle traps and rhomboids, are likely to be overstretched. Orthotics can help activate muscles that haven't been fully exercised and give them guidance on where they need to go.

Proprioception helps you move freely without having to stop and think about every movement. It allows you to close your eyes and touch your nose with your fingers, walk down stairs without looking at every step, or sit in a chair without looking under your hips.

Orthotics allow us to build on proprioception, making us more acutely aware of what good posture feels like and what we need to do to achieve it. If I start sluggish, the posture corrector will let me know I'm in the wrong position so I can pull my shoulders back or tighten my lower back. Ideally, eventually this correction will become second nature.

How to choose a posture corrector

There's no data on which type of aligner works best, and Rodriguez says any aligner can be beneficial if you use it correctly in your everyday life (no, you shouldn't wear one to bed). If you're ready to give it a try, here are a few things to keep in mind:

Does it target your weak spots? There are different posture correctors for different parts of the body. The most common are your shoulders, cervicothoracic junction (where your upper back meets your neck), and your lumbar spine. If you're not sure where your weakness is, take a look at your posture from the waist up to pinpoint the source of your listlessness. Is your back arching too much? Try braces with lumbar support. Are your shoulders hunched or your neck leaning forward? Consider a method that helps keep your shoulders down and back. If you do get lost, Rodriguez recommends seeing a physical therapist to help you choose the one that fits your needs and focus on the areas that need support the most.

Does it fit comfortably? You want breathable materials that feel good on your skin and don't cause chafing. It shouldn't contort your body into unnatural positions or immobilize you too rigidly. "If it's uncomfortable, it's not going to work because you're not going to use it," Rodriguez said.

Can I use it myself? You don't want a device that requires a PhD to operate. You want to be able to put it on, adjust and take it off without having to rely on anyone else to help you tighten the strap or take it off you.

Does it look ok? See how it fits under your clothes. You will most likely want to hide the pose corrector.

Is the price right? Posture correctors with technical components tend to be more expensive than other types.
